About Techtronic Industries EMEA

Techtronic Industries EMEA is a rapidly expanding global leader in Power Tools, Accessories, Hand Tools, Outdoor Power Equipment, and Floor Care Appliances for DIY enthusiasts, professionals, and industrial users. Our products drive innovation across the home improvement, repair, maintenance, construction, and infrastructure sectors, revolutionizing these industries with our eco-friendly cordless technology.

Our renowned brands, including MILWAUKEE, RYOBI, and AEG, are recognized worldwide for their rich heritage, superior quality, outstanding performance, and innovative designs. We are dedicated to cordless technology and innovation, combined with strong customer partnerships, which allows us to deliver exciting new products that enhance customer satisfaction and boost productivity, providing a strong foundation for sustainable leadership and growth.

The Techtronic Industries EMEA region spans a wide range of countries, employing around 3,750 people from diverse cultural backgrounds. We value cultural diversity and believe in the power of collaboration and learning from each other. We invest in our people, offering extensive training in various areas and encouraging exploration of other locations worldwide.

Our EMEA headquarters are located in Maidenhead, UK, and Winnenden, Germany.
